Linda and I have been collectively sick and tired of hooking up our computers to our apartment's TV so we can watch DVDs.  For the uninitiated to Shanghai's Expat culture, DVDs are the Number 1 escape mechanism from <a href="http://english.cctv.com/index.shtml" title="Opiates for the Expat Masses - A Window To The World On China!">CCTV9</a> - unless you're hooked on dodgy satellite TV beamed in from overhead.
</p><p>
It was getting tedious.  At the moment, Lin and I are hooked on <a href="http://www.lost-tv.com/" title="Lost - I think the big creature is my boss">Lost</a>.  We've powered through the series in the last 2 weeks, and now there's only a few episodes to go.  We also wanted a remote for f#ck sakes!
</p><p>
So, on our usual weekly/fortnightly/we have no food trip to the Wuning Lu <a href="http://www.cityweekend.com.cn/en/shanghai/cib/2005_05/S1114679230" title="Big W meets Woolworths - Get it all in one!">Carrefour</a>, we purchased a new DVD player.  All RMB400 worth (about AUD$60).  We bought an <a href="http://www.oritron.com/" title="should be 'pants-branded'">Oritron-branded</a> DVD player, it looked sweet.  It was a lemon.  We took it home, hooked it up, and our problems started.
</p><p>
Firstly, our apartment's TV rear input plugs don't work.  We found this out the hard way before.  Luckily there's side AV input ports that work a treat.  Secondly, we should have checked out the player in the store - as countless people have told me since.  My smallest gripe was that the remote was entirely in Chinese, there were no English menu controls on the DVD menu.  I could live with that.  It might give me the opportunity to absorb more Hanzi (YESSSS! I can now recognise the Chinese characters for 'Frame Advance'!  Now that's handy!).
</p><p>
My major gripes were as follows.  It wouldn't turn on.  Well, you would plug it in, and the player power button wouldn't work - most of the time.  Unplug, wait for 5-10 minutes, and then it would work.  Strange.  The converse was also true, you couldn't turn the thing off.  Unplugging it was the main way we got around this. No worries right?  Nah.  The discs we put into the machine would stall, cause the player to crash, and other such petulant behaviour.  Annoying.
</p><p>
But the crux of our decision was the fact that a lovely surprise was included inside the player.  To our delight, we were given the added bonus of the '<em>Adult Tempt</em>' DVD.  Lovely.  It had several, suspicious, greasy fingerprints on the bottom side of the disc.  I think '<em>the playa'</em>, as it will now be known, had seen some action.  Startled at this, we had a good laugh.  Lin later put the DVD on for some comical Asian porn plots.  It was pretty cheesy - that lasted all of about 1 minute before we tried episodes of <a href="http://www.lost-tv.com/" title="Lost - Otherwise, I think the big creature is Little Johnny Howard's ego">Lost</a>.  <em>The Playa</em> apparently only liked the porn disc, but what would you expect from a machine that has been around the block several times.
</p><p>
The sum of all parts meant that I wanted to take it back.  And I did this last night.  Carrefour happily took back the player, despite the fact I forgot to bring the remote with me.  The truthfulness in me blurted out '<em>I forgot to bring it!</em>' when the shop assistant asked '<em>It didn't have a remote inside?</em>'.  (And no, my Chinese comprehension isn't that good, he spoke English quite well).  Despite this, they accepted the refund, we got our cash, and then a one-on-one personal service to ensure we got a good DVD player at the store.  We picked up a <a href="http://www.chinadesay.com/en/aboutus/index.htm" title="Desay - They also made our GE branded cordless phone, that was a dud by the way">Desay</a> player, checked it out in the store.  We were happy - now we are capable of DVD watching with a remote!  Yeah!
</p><p>
We picked up a few things, waited in the checkout line for ages (mental note - no Carrefour trips after 8pm at night EVER again).  We got home just before 10pm.  Hooked up the DVD player, got our <a href="http://www.lost-tv.com/" title="Lost - It ROCKS!">Lost</a> fix, and dreamt of sweet DVD watching experiences.
